Teen charged as adult in connection with deadly shooting in Munhall

A 16-year-old boy remained in Allegheny County Jail on Friday afternoon on charges that he fatally shot a man two weeks ago in Munhall.

Allegheny County Police responded around 4 a.m. Nov. 15 to the 500 block of East Ninth Avenue for reports of a shooting, police spokesman Jim Madalinsky said Friday.

First responders found a man inside an apartment, suffering from gunshot wounds, Madalinsky said. The victim, later identified as Dontae Hatcher, 33, died at the scene.

Allegheny County Police said Raylon Williams, 16, was responsible for the shooting and also threatened another person inside the apartment, Madalinsky said. Williams was taken into custody Thursday without incident.

County police charged Williams as an adult with homicide and two counts of making terroristic threats, court records show.

District Judge Craig C. Stephens denied Williams bail on Friday, court records show.

Williams’ attorney is not listed in court records. A preliminary hearing is scheduled for Dec. 8, court records show.
